[jboss-svn-commits] JBL Code SVN: r35728 - labs/jbosslabs/labs-3.0-build/integration/sbs/reports/trunk/src/main/java/org/jboss/community/sbs/plugin/reports/monthly/config.
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Tue Oct 26 03:37:54 EDT 2010
Author: velias
Date: 2010-10-26 03:37:52 -0400 (Tue, 26 Oct 2010)
New Revision: 35728
Modified:
labs/jbosslabs/labs-3.0-build/integration/sbs/reports/trunk/src/main/java/org/jboss/community/sbs/plugin/reports/monthly/config/ReportConfigParser.java
Log:
Added notes for configuration file format into javadoc
Modified: labs/jbosslabs/labs-3.0-build/integration/sbs/reports/trunk/src/main/java/org/jboss/community/sbs/plugin/reports/monthly/config/ReportConfigParser.java
===================================================================
--- labs/jbosslabs/labs-3.0-build/integration/sbs/reports/trunk/src/main/java/org/jboss/community/sbs/plugin/reports/monthly/config/ReportConfigParser.java 2010-10-26 00:29:16 UTC (rev 35727)
+++ labs/jbosslabs/labs-3.0-build/integration/sbs/reports/trunk/src/main/java/org/jboss/community/sbs/plugin/reports/monthly/config/ReportConfigParser.java 2010-10-26 07:37:52 UTC (rev 35728)
@@ -36,6 +36,18 @@
* </projects>
* </pre>
*
+ * Some notes for configuration file format:
+ * <ul>
+ * <li><code>project</code> elements may be multiplied.
+ * <li><code>project at name</code> attribute is mandatory (can't be empty).
+ * <li><code>jira</code>, <code>sbs</code>, <code>sbs/user</code>, <code>sbs/dev</code> and <code>fisheye</code>
+ * elements may be empty.
+ * <li><code>project-key</code> and <code>space</code> elements may be empty.
+ * <li><code>project-key</code>, <code>space</code> and <code>repo</code> elements may be multiplied.
+ * <li><code>repo at name</code> attribute is mandatory (can't be empty). So remove whole <code>repo</code> element.
+ * <li><code>repo at path</code> attribute is optional (can be empty or not present).
+ * </ul>
+ *
* @author Vlastimil Elias (velias at redhat dot com)
*/
public class ReportConfigParser {
More information about the jboss-svn-commits
mailing list